Airlines tumble 31% in 2011; outlook cloudy for 2012

제출됨
 
WASHINGTON (MarketWatch) — Airline stocks on ended a rough year deep in the red on Friday as sputtering demand and soaring fuel prices squeezed the industry’s profits, and 2012 is expected to be just as challenging. (www.marketwatch.com) 기타...
